Class PdfDigitalSignatureDetails
Der Name: Aspose.Tasks.Saving Versammlung: Aspose.Tasks.dll (25.5.0)
Es enthält Details für eine PDF-Digitale Unterschrift.
public class PdfDigitalSignatureDetailsInheritance
object ← PdfDigitalSignatureDetails
Vererbte Mitglieder
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Remarks
Aktuell sind PDF-Dokumente, die digital unterschrieben werden, nur auf .NET 2.0 oder höher verfügbar.
Constructors
PdfDigitalSignatureDetails(X509Certificate2, String, String, DateTime, PdfDigitalSignatureHashAlgorithm)
Initialisiert eine neue Instanz der Aspose.Tasks.Saving.PdfDigitalSignatureDetails Klasse.
public PdfDigitalSignatureDetails(X509Certificate2 certificate, string reason, string location, DateTime signatureDate, PdfDigitalSignatureHashAlgorithm hashAlgorithm)Parameters
certificate X509Certificate2
Die System.Security.Cryptography.X509Certificates.X509Certificate2 zum Unterzeichnen.
reason string
Der Grund für die Unterzeichnung.
location string
Der Standort der Unterschrift.
signatureDate DateTime
Datum der Unterzeichnung.
hashAlgorithm PdfDigitalSignatureHashAlgorithm
Das Hash-Algorithmus der Unterzeichnung.
Properties
Certificate
Er erhält oder stellt das Zertifikat zur Unterzeichnung mit.
public X509Certificate2 Certificate { get; set; }Eigentumswert
HashAlgorithm
Gibt oder setzt das Hash-Algorithmus.
public PdfDigitalSignatureHashAlgorithm HashAlgorithm { get; set; }Eigentumswert
PdfDigitalSignatureHashAlgorithm
Location
Sie erhalten oder legen die Unterschriftstelle fest.
public string Location { get; set; }Eigentumswert
Reason
Gibt oder legt den Grund für die Unterzeichnung fest.
public string Reason { get; set; }Eigentumswert
SignatureDate
Sie erhalten oder legen die Unterzeichnungsdatum fest.
public DateTime SignatureDate { get; set; }